The San Francisco Ballet said that it had made “emergency contingency plans” that could result in the cancellation of a planned New York tour, including performances at Lincoln Center, if the union representing its dancers does not meet a deadline for accepting what the ballet called its “last, best and final offer.” The contract between the ballet and its dancers expired on June 30, and talks have turned heated. The dancers said in a statement that they are seeking “provisions that demonstrate a sufficient level of respect” and “protections against bullying by the artistic staff,” while the ballet said in its own statement that its most recent contract with its dancers made them “among the most highly compensated professional dancers in the country.”
